The Ford F4TF-12A650-PB Electronic Control Module (ECM) is a crucial component for the engine management system in select 1994 F-250 and F-350 models equipped with the 5.8L ESCH V8 engine and the E4OD transmission with Keg1 transfer case. This ECM is specifically designed to meet the unique requirements of these vehicles, ensuring optimal engine performance and emissions compliance.

This advanced electronic control module is engineered to manage various engine functions, including fuel injection, ignition timing, engine idle speed, and emissions control systems. By precisely controlling these functions, it enhances fuel efficiency, reduces exhaust emissions, and ensures reliable engine performance.
